Output c43660f98d98ddd51e12cb31d17b1b91be90ef67b800a8125aa6b0ebb68af036:13

value
737066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8a2eb556d4fc216ba97b80e0cb191a3792c6e5b OP_EQUAL
address
3Nu5rssW5G3LECq3JFo6zEBKQFJGeQc1Nx
transaction
c43660f98d98ddd51e12cb31d17b1b91be90ef67b800a8125aa6b0ebb68af036
spent
true